Honigman announced that George Stowe has joined the firm as a partner in the Private Equity group of its Corporate Department. As the eleventh partner to join Honigman’s Chicago office this year, he joins after over five years with Benesch, Friedlander, Coplan & Aronoff.
“George brings a tremendous depth of experience that will be a valuable addition to our department, the firm, and our clients,” said Kimberly A. Dudek, chair of Honigman’s Corporate Department and member of the firm’s Executive Committee. “He is the twenty-first team member to join our expanding Corporate Department this year and we are excited to integrate his expertise into our already dynamic and talented team.”
Stowe focuses his practice on private equity (PE) transactions and business mergers & acquisitions (M&A), and sales. He has spearheaded several PE transactions and advised intricate middle-market PE funds, independent sponsors, and their portfolio companies. His clientele spans several industries, including business services, consumer products, food and beverage, franchise businesses, health care, industrial services, and manufacturing. Stowe also advises on general corporate matters, including entity formation, equity holder agreements, governance, and other day-to-day projects. Additionally, he works with publicly and privately held companies on a broad range of matters, including divestitures, minority investments, and other strategic transactions.
